Protein Components and Antigens of the Venezuelan Equine Encephalomyelitis Virus
Abstract
The protein composition of highly purified Venzuelan equine encephalomyelitis virus (VEE) was studied by the methods of electrophoresis in polyacrilamide gel and double diffusion in agar. Coincidence of the results obtained by the two indicated methods permits the conclusion to be drawn that three virus-specific proteins are present in the structure of VEE virions.
